vertex & x and y intercepts of f(x)=x^2

Answer:

vertex (0, 0)

x-intercept: 0

y-intercept: 0

Step-by-step explanation:

The vertex form of a quadratic function:

[tex]f(x)=a(x-h)^2+k[/tex]

(h, k) - vertex

We have

[tex]f(x)=x^2=1(x-0)^2+0[/tex]

Therefore the vertex is in (0, 0).

The x-intercept for y = 0. Substitute:

[tex]x^2=0\to x=0[/tex]

The y-intercept for x = 0. Substitute:

[tex]y=0^2\to y=0[/tex]
